The Manufacturing Engineering Manager is responsible for leading a team of engineers in the development, implementation, and optimization of manufacturing processes to improve efficiency, quality, and cost-effectiveness. This role collaborates cross-functionally with production, quality, maintenance, and design engineering teams to support continuous improvement, new product introduction, and equipment upgrades.
Key Responsibilities:
Lead, mentor, and managing a team of manufacturing engineers and technicians. Drive a business partner approach between operations and manufacturing engineering. Align Manufacturing Engineers’ metrics with corresponding business partners.
Develop, implement, and optimize manufacturing processes to improve productivity, reduce waste, and enhance product quality.
Develop, implement, and manage a multi-year Factory Master Plan aligned with Strategic Planning efforts.
Manage division CapEx funding plan and execution. Coordinate with Finance & Procurement to manage budget, align priorities and execute per business needs.
Plan and execute continuous improvement initiatives (Lean, Six Sigma, Kaizen, etc.).
Oversee equipment specification, procurement, installation, and commissioning.
Support New Product Introductions (NPIs), ensuring seamless integration into production.
Manage capital projects and coordinate with vendors and contractors as needed.
Collaborate with Quality, Maintenance, and Operations to resolve production issues.
Develop and maintain work instructions, process documentation, and standard operating procedures.
Ensure compliance with safety, quality, and regulatory standards (e.g., ISO, OSHA).
Monitor and report on key performance indicators (KPIs), including cycle times, scrap rates, and process uptime.
Provide technical guidance and engineering support to manufacturing operations.
